Adjunct Professor Sze-Wee Tan
Affiliations
Advisor, Ecosystem Enablement (Healthcare & Lifescience), Temasek Singapore Pte Ltd
Adjunct Professor, Duke-NUS Medical School Singapore
Profile
Education and Training : Professor Tan graduated with MBBS from National University of Singapore (NUS), and attained his MBA from Warwick University, UK. He attended the Stanford Executive Programme at the Stanford University’s Graduate School Business, and was awarded a certificate of completion for the Senior Fellowship in Public Service Programme, Lee Kuan Yew School of Public Policy in Singapore. Prof Tan also attended the Executive Leadership Programme from the Singapore Civil Service College. He is an affiliate member of the Faculty of Pharmaceutical Medicine, Royal College of Physicians, UK. He is a registered medical practitioner with the Singapore Medical Council.
Leadership Appontment : Prof Tan Sze Wee, is currently Advisor to Temasek Singapore Pte Ltd. Temasek is a global investment company headquartered in Singapore with a multinational staff of over 900 people. Prof Tan will be supporting Temasek at BioSparc in Suzhou. This is a China-Singapore Life Sciences Park, which Temasek is working on with Suzhou Industrial Park. It aims to build on the SIP’s strengths in the biomedical sector, providing research and development centres and manufacturing facilities to advance cutting-edge innovations from drug development and medical devices to artificial intelligence-driven medical technologies.
Between 2009 to 2025, Prof Tan served various leadership roles in the Agency for Science, Technology and Research (A*STAR), which is Singapore's lead public sector R&D agency. As a Science and Technology Organisation, A*STAR bridges the gap between academia and industry. A*STAR's R&D activities span biomedical sciences to physical sciences and engineering, with over 6,000 staff within 17 research entities and national platforms primarily located in Biopolis and Fusionopolis.
Prof Tan’s career in A*STAR started in 2009. He was first appointed as Programme Director of the A*STAR Medical Technology initiative in Science and Engineering Research Council (SERC), that led in the partnership with Stanford BioDesign @ Stanford University, and Center for Integration of Medicine & Innovative Technology (CIMIT) in Massachusetts General Hospital in Boston, USA. Prof Tan was subsequently appointed as Director (SERC), where he oversaw all SERC cluster-led research and development (R&D). From 2012 to 2015, Prof Tan was Deputy Executive Director (DED), Biomedical Research Council (BMRC) and his cross-Council experience enabled A*STAR to engage companies across industry sectors.
In 2016, Prof Tan was appointed ED, SERC and was subsequently redesignated as Assistant Chief Executive (ACE), SERC in 2019. As ACE SERC, Prof Tan drove the implementation of strategic plans and initiatives set for A*STAR in the Science and Engineering areas. Prof Tan was appointed ACE, Innovation and Enterprise as well as Acting Chief Executive of A*ccelerate Technologies Pte Ltd in 2020. He aligned A*STAR industry engagement, licensing and venture creation value chain among the A*STAR Research Institutes and the National Platforms. This is to drive efforts to translate A*STAR’s R&D to market so as to enable research-fuelled economic and societal impact.
From 2023 to 2025, Prof Tan was appointed ACE BMRC. BMRC supports, oversees and coordinates public sector biomedical research and development activities in Singapore to cultivate a thriving biomedical cluster. At BMRC, he oversaw the development of core research capabilities in bioprocessing, genomics and proteomics, molecular and cell biology, bioengineering and nanotechnology, and computational biology. Prof Tan also served on the governance committee of National Platforms Diagnostic Development Hub (DxDHub), Experimental Drug Development Centre (EDDC) and Medtech Catapult.
Prior to these roles, Prof Tan was the Managing Director and Chief Executive Officer of Rockeby biomed Limited from 2001 to 2009. He was the Asia-Pacific Associate Regional Medical Director for Mead Johnson Nutritional’s, a division pf Bristol-Myers Squibb Company from 1997 to 2001.
Academic, Clinical and Innovation Focus : Professor Tan constantly promotes international research, innovation and enterprise partnership between Singapore, A*STAR and its key scientific, industry and venture building partners across the world. He has forged bilateral research partnership programmes between Singapore and China, Germany, Korea, Japan, New Zealand. He is a speaker at international conferences on topics around medical technologies, AI in Healthtech, and advises academic, corporate and not for profit organisations for wide range of topics. Within A*STAR, he oversees close to 2,000 research scientists and engineers during his stint at BMRC and SERC, each with annual operating budget of US$300M.
Professional Service: Professor Tan has served on various national committees in Singapore. He is a member of the Board Oversight Committee for Advanced Cell Therapy and Research Institute, Singapore (ACTRIS). He is a board member of the Singapore Eye Research Institute (SERI) as well as a member of its Incubator Advisory Board for the SERI Ophthalmic Technologies Incubator Phase II Program. He is a council member of the Singapore Medical Association (SMA), as well as a board director for SMA Pte Ltd. Prof Tan is also the Chairman of Unlocking ADHD Ltd.
Awards & Honours : Professor Tan was a former Nominated Member of Parliament of Singapore,
and is a recipient of the Singapore Public Administration Medal (Silver) as
well as the Singapore (Covid-19) Public Administration Medal (Silver).
He has also received the Friend of Labour Award.
